Output 3d70cc429e0471548abb279aca5ed97cfc86394f449b9e1a2d7efcf240f07856:1

value
9666842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 837a3b3654171adcb9356e1d2554ea44ca1788a1 OP_EQUAL
address
MKtMBLe6AXfidgu2gFsvGFeF7ecqUPTSsC
transaction
3d70cc429e0471548abb279aca5ed97cfc86394f449b9e1a2d7efcf240f07856
spent
true